Understanding the Importance of Timing
Timing is an essential aspect to consider when conducting your first hive inspection. The success of this critical process heavily relies on the timing, and ignoring it can lead to missed opportunities for detection of issues within the colony.
Weather conditions significantly impact a successful inspection. Avoid inspecting during extreme temperatures or precipitation, as these conditions often prevent you from accessing the hives safely. Optimal times for inspections usually occur when temperatures are mild, ideally between 10 am to 4 pm. This allows for better visibility and easier handling of frames without putting yourself at risk.
Additionally, consider the age of your colony. A young colony (less than three months old) typically requires more frequent monitoring as it is more susceptible to issues such as swarming or queen failure. For established colonies, less frequent inspections are usually sufficient. Understanding these factors will help you schedule a suitable time for inspection and ensure that your colony receives the necessary attention during its critical developmental stages.
Be prepared to adjust your inspection timing according to weather changes and the stage of your colony’s development.
Gathering Essential Equipment and Supplies
Before heading out to inspect your hive for the first time, it’s essential to gather all the necessary equipment and supplies. This will not only ensure a safe and successful inspection but also help you stay organized and focused on what needs to be done.
First and foremost, prioritize protective gear. A beekeeping suit, veil, gloves, and a smoker are must-haves for any inspection. A good quality beekeeping suit should fit comfortably and provide adequate protection from stings. The veil will shield your face from stray bees, while the gloves will prevent stings on your hands.
In terms of tools, you’ll need a hive tool to open the hive, a frame grip to handle the frames, and a brush to gently sweep away debris. A ladder or step stool may also be necessary for accessing the hive. Don’t forget to pack any medications you might need in case of an emergency, such as epinephrine auto-injectors or antihistamines.

Approaching the Hive with Caution
When approaching the hive for the first time, it’s essential to exercise caution and respect for the bees’ space. This is not just a matter of safety; it also sets the tone for a productive inspection. Start by standing off to the side, about 10-15 feet away from the hive entrance. Take a moment to observe the hive’s activity, noting any signs of aggression or disturbance.
Before approaching the hive, ensure you’re wearing your full beekeeping gear, including a veil and gloves. This will not only protect you from potential stings but also help you maintain a safe distance. Once you’re geared up, slowly begin to move towards the hive entrance, keeping an eye on the bees’ behavior. If they appear agitated or aggressive, it’s best to postpone the inspection until another time.

Implementing Any Necessary Actions or Preparations
As you review the findings from your first hive inspection, it’s essential to take corrective actions to address any issues that may impact the health and productivity of your colony. If you’ve identified pests or diseases, such as varroa mites or American Foulbrood, treat your hive promptly according to established guidelines.
For example, if you’ve detected signs of varroa mites, apply an integrated pest management (IPM) strategy that includes treating the hive with medication and taking steps to prevent re-infestation. This might involve monitoring for mite populations regularly, using drone brood suppression techniques, or introducing mite-resistant bees.
Additionally, adjust your feeding schedule if necessary. If you’ve determined that your colony is experiencing a food shortage, consider supplementing their diet with a high-quality bee feed. On the other hand, if they’re producing excessive honey, reduce feeding to prevent overfeeding and related issues.
Prepare for swarming by inspecting for queen cells and making any necessary adjustments to promote brood balance. This might involve splitting the colony or introducing a new queen to control population growth.

Preparing for Future Inspections and Seasonal Changes
As you wrap up your first hive inspection, it’s essential to prepare for future inspections and adapt to seasonal changes. This will ensure your colony remains healthy and productive throughout the year.
To prepare for future inspections, make sure to:
* Keep detailed records of your inspections, including notes on the queen’s condition, brood patterns, and any issues you’ve encountered.
* Create a maintenance schedule to stay on top of tasks like cleaning the hive, checking for pests, and performing splits or re-queening as needed.
As seasonal changes affect nectar flow and other environmental factors, your colony will require adjustments. For example:
* During periods of low nectar flow, ensure you’re providing supplemental food sources like sugar water to keep your bees well-fed.
* In areas with harsh winters, take steps to winterize your hive by adding insulation, reducing the entrance, and ensuring a reliable food source is available.
Regular maintenance and adaptation will help your colony thrive despite seasonal fluctuations. By staying proactive, you’ll be better equipped to address challenges as they arise and ensure a successful beekeeping season.

How often should I inspect my hive after the initial assessment?
Regular inspections are essential for maintaining a healthy colony. Schedule follow-up visits every 7-10 days during peak nectar flow periods and monthly during slower seasons to monitor progress and address any emerging issues.
